Abstract(in English) When several nonlinear elements are contained in the circuit, it can be imagined easily that phenomena in the complicated systems are exhibited. Though several chaotic circuits which can behave the coexistence phenomena have been proposed, a chaotic circuit which contains symmetrical piecewise linear resistors can generate both chaotic and periodic oscillations at the same parameters in a 3-dimensional chaotic circuit is proposed in this study. Those phenomena are analyzed and confirmed by both numerical simulation and circuit experiment. This is the realization of coexistence phenomena by which designe a positive region in the piecewise linear resistors, then chaotic and periodic region can be separated. The design scheme and those phenomena, bifurcation diagram, application are reported.
